JPA GROUP BY实体 – 这可能吗?

是否可以通过引用实体进行分组来选择JPA中的数据?

我的意思是:我有两个实体 – 保险和参考多对一车辆。 保险实体有validTill字段(当然还有车辆字段)。

我想选择车辆,这是最新的保险。 以下查询不起作用:

SELECT DISTINCT v.vehicle, max(v.validTill) as lastValidTill FROM TraInsurance v GROUP BY v.vehicle ORDER BY lastValidTill 

上面的查询失败并显示错误:

 ERROR: column "travehicle1_.id_brand" must appear in the GROUP BY clause or be used in an aggregate function 

这是因为JPA将引用车辆的所有字段添加到查询而不是GROUP BY。 这是我做错了吗? 或者也许只是不可能这样做?

请在此用例中明确使用JOIN

 SELECT ve, MAX(v.validTill) FROM TraInsurance v JOIN v.vehicle ve GROUP BY ve ORDER BY MAX(v.validTill) 

显然JPA规范允许,但至少Hibernate的实现不支持它(参见HHH-2436和HHH-1615 )。

如果在GROUP BY中传递一个实体,Hibernate会自动将其id添加到底层数据库的转换后的SQL中。 此外,GROUP BY中的值必须存在于SELECT子句中。 因此,您可以选择其ID,而不是选择整个对象,然后从这些ID中 ,您可以再次检索该对象。

  SELECT DISTINCT v.vehicle.id, max(v.validTill) FROM TraInsurance v GROUP BY v.vehicle.id ORDER BY max(v.validTill) 

如果需要时间并且需要DB命中从其ID中检索Vehicle对象,则可以在SELECT中选择所有Vehicle的属性并将它们放入GROUP BY中。 然后,您可以从这些属性构造Vehicle对象,而无需访问DB。
